WebAll the Pretty Horses. The movie is set in the early 1950s. It begins in San Angelo, West Texas (about halfway between Dallas and El Paso, and 150 miles north of the Mexican border), and it travels on horseback down into a ranch, roughly the size of the King Ranch, in the state of Coahuila, Mexico. There is great significance in the setting because the story takes place in two contrasting locations, Texas and Mexico, rather than one central location. The novel opens up in Texas, in 1950. The opening scene is at John Grady Cole’s grandfather’s funeral.
